This course is a continuation of Dance 120B. Students are expected to be familiar with basic ballet terminology including feet and arm positions, specific ballet steps including adagio and allegro combinations, basic turns and leaps in the classical ballet tradition. Course expectations include improved technical movement skills, musical awareness, and introduction to performance qualities of classical ballet. Prerequisites: DANC 120B Credit Hours: 2 Repeat/Retake Information: May be repeated for a maximum of 6 hours.
